Leggett & Platt Acquisition by Somnigroup Clears HSR Hurdle, Expected to Close by Year-End
Summary
The Hart-Scott-Rodino (HSR) antitrust waiting period for Somnigroup's acquisition of Leggett & Platt has expired, removing a key regulatory hurdle for the transaction. This news follows the 8-K and 425 filings earlier today by Leggett & Platt, which also announced the HSR expiration. The expiration of the HSR waiting period is a significant step towards completing the acquisition, reducing regulatory risk and increasing the certainty of the deal closing. The company expects the acquisition to close by year-end 2026, pending shareholder approval and other foreign regulatory clearances.
At the time of this announcement, LEG was trading at $9.75 on NYSE in the Manufacturing sector, with a market capitalization of approximately $1.3B. The 52-week trading range was $7.86 to $13.00.
